Rocardio wrote:You may not use, edit, or otherwise publsih this work unless directed by the author, in any creative or other means (as approved) not claimed or otherwise demonstonstrated as being the sole property of anyone but the respictave author.
In case you are not aware, Wesnoth is distributed under the GPL. Arguably, what you have already posted is a derivative work of Wesnoth and is already subject to the GPL. (This point could probably be disputed, since Wesnoth did not originate the concept of nagas.) No one is really going to contest the issue while your ideas are simply a forum post. However, if you really want to get these units into mainline, they would definitely come under the GPL. And if you choose to upload these units in an add-on, uploads to the official server must be licensed under the GPL as well.
